Fiji Agriculture Profile 2012
Fiji's economy is based primarily on agriculture. A wide variety of tropical crops are grown for local consumption; sugarcane and coconuts are produced chiefly as commercial crops. Raw sugar accounts for the major part of Fiji's export earnings. Other exports include fish, gold, petroleum products, and timber.
